CrIn2S4 is a ternary metal sulfide compound combining chromium and indium, belonging to the thiospinel family of materials. This compound is primarily of research and development interest rather than established industrial production, with potential applications in solid-state electronics, photovoltaic systems, and catalysis due to its mixed-valence transition metal chemistry and semiconductor properties.
